tpWallet 兑换遇到无反应时,往往涉及多层原因。本文从前端、后端、链上与支付网关四个层级出发,给出系统性诊断框架,并在每个层级提供可执行的要点,以帮助开发者、运营和安全团队快速定位问题、提升鲁棒性与防护水平。
一、防越权访问的设计要点
在任何涉及资金交易的场景中 防越权访问都是第一道防线。应实现最小权限原则、分离职责和强认证。具体做法包括对接口采用基于角色的访问控制和设备绑定,使用多因素认证和短期访问令牌,建立会话超时策略,对异常登录进行告警并记录完整日志。对敏感操作设置分级审批和回滚能力,固定的凭证轮换周期,以及对关键节点的IP白名单和地理区域访问限制。
二、合约验证的要点
兑换流程中可能涉及到链上合约交互。为防止错误地址与未验证代码带来的风险,需要对合约地址进行严格校验,确保 ABI 与代码版本匹配,启用对等链的公开源代码核验,记录合约哈希与发行信息。对新版本合约实行灰度发布与可回滚机制,建立离线验签与监控告警,及时发现异常铸币或交易逻辑失效。
三、专家剖析给出多维视角

多位专家指出 兑换无响应往往不是单点故障,而是前端请求被后端网关拦截、RPC 接口不可用或队列积压导致的连锁反应。应监控端到端的延迟分布,关注峰值时段的限流策略,检查缓存与数据库的健康状况,以及日志的完整性。对比不同地区的节点状态,排除网络分区和区域性故障的可能性。

四、扫码支付流程的可靠性要点
扫码支付要确保从二维码生成到支付结果回传的全链路健壮性。应实现幂等性、回调幂等与超时重试策略,避免重复扣款或状态错乱。对扫描设备进行兼容性测试,提供离线兜底方案和快速失败友好提示,确保网络波动时仍能提供明确的交易状态反馈。
五、密钥管理的安全要点
密钥是资产安全的核心。应对密钥进行本地加密存储、在硬件托管环境或受信设备中执行私钥操作,避免明文暴露。建立分级备份、助记词分权保管、定期轮换和应急恢复流程。对密钥相关日志进行保护,防止敏感信息泄露,建立密钥泄露告警与快速撤销措施。
六、代币增发的治理与监控要点
代币增发需遵循治理规则和授权约束,确保只有经合法授权的账户能够发起铸币。对增发事件设置审批、资金与权限分离、以及实时的链上审计日志。建立异常增发的监控阈值,配合社群和安全团队的合规审查,防止单点滥用与恶意铸币。
七、故障排查的落地清单
在面对兑换无反应时,应遵循自上而下的排查法:检查服务器与网络状态,查看最近的部署变更,核对日志的错误码与追踪信息,验证外部依赖是否可用,测试不同地区节点的连通性,评估限流策略是否引发瓶颈,并制定可行的回滚与应急预案。
结语
tpWallet 的可靠性来自系统各层的协同防护与持续演练。通过完善的防越权访问、严格的合约验证、专业的专家分析、稳健的扫码支付、严格的密钥管理和清晰的代币增发治理,可以显著提升遇到兑换无反应时的诊断效率与恢复速度,同时建议定期进行安全演练与日志审计,不断优化用户体验与安全合规并重。
评论